Solidity Blockchain Developer at SharesPost

SharesPost is looking for a full-time, mid-level solidity developer working in San Francisco, California. The ideal candidate would have experience with Solidity, Ethereum, Blockchain, and Javascript.

Job description

Are you a blockchain developer who loves to learn new things? Are you passionate about honing your skills?

If so, SharesPost, a leading financial company that has transacted over four billion dollars worth of assets, is looking for you. We need your help building our best-in-class private equity and blockchain token trading marketplace.

What you will be doing

  • Writing Solidity smart contracts for SharesPost’s blockchain services
  • Integrating ERC20 tokens into the sharesposts marketplace
  • Writing web3, React and Javascript dApp code
  • Scaling a high performance financial application
  • Building APIs for our React front end
  • Working with Blockchains, Distributed Ledgers, SQL and NoSQL data
  • Applying your understanding of algorithms and data structures
  • Writing unit tests & integration tests
  • Researching new technologies and better ways of doing things
  • Peer reviewing pull requests

Our team values

  • Passion for agile software practices and test driven development
  • Curiosity to understand business stakeholders and build great user-friendly software
  • Drive to build powerful new technology that changes how capital markets work
  • Ability to give and receive feedback to improve our skills and processes
  • Openness in sharing knowledge and expertise with teammates
  • Excitement about the financial services that power the startup and innovation economy

About SharesPost

SharesPost is an SEC-registered broker-dealer, investment advisor and an approved Alternative Trading System. SharesPost helped launch the private tech growth market in 2009 and has built one of the leading platforms for secondary transactions and Initial Coin Offerings pursuant to Reg. D. SharesPost provides the private tech asset category with a suite of trading and lending solutions to facilitate shareholder and option holder liquidity. With more than $4 billion in secondary market transactions for more than 200 leading technology companies, SharesPost provides the trading, research and online tools to transact in the private market with confidence.

What can you expect during the interview?

After you contact us we will get in touch with you to start the interview process. Here’s what the interview looks like:

  1. We will send you a coding challenge that you can complete from the comfort of your own favorite work environment with access to the internet. The coding challenge takes 2 to 4 hours. This is your opportunity to demonstrate your ability to write easy to read, tested and maintainable code.
  2. We’ll review your challenge solution and if it meets the team’s technical standards we will invite you to an interview at SharesPost in San Francisco. Then you can meet the team in person and learn more about us.
  3. Our team will discuss your interview and if it’s a good match you will receive a job offer from us.

Start to finish the whole process should take about 1 to 2 weeks.

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

About SharesPost

SharesPost is looking to hire engineers that want to join a rapidly growing team that encourages a culture of collaboration, education, and product ownership. We’ve worked with some of the best engineering shops in the SF area, and are excited to bring those best-in-class practices in house.

This includes:

  • Paired Programming (encouraged, but not required).
  • Applying an existing skill set while building experience in new languages.
  • Weekly Developer Chats to discuss interesting topics and problems.
  • Weekly retros to review what we liked and what we wished had gone differently.

We’re not looking for coders that are only interested in blindly picking up the next bug or feature in the queue. We want thought leaders and problem solvers that are aligned with the company mission, driven by solving real-world problems in efficient and innovative ways, and excited to work with a team of engineers that share similar values. 


  • Paired Programming
  • Commuter Benefits
  • Medical/Dental/Vision coverage
  • Annual Retreat
  • Competitive Pay & Equity
  • Catered Birthday Lunches
  • Close to several public transportation routes
  • Developer knowledge sharing and education